  • CakePHP

    CakePHP: The Rapid Development Framework for PHP - Official Repository

  • CakePHP is an open-source PHP framework for web development with 8.7k stars and 3.5k forks on GitHub. It offers APIs that enable developers to develop applications quickly. It allows you to create highly secure and scalable web applications, including social networks, eCommerce, and online collaboration platforms.

  • Laravel

    Laravel is a web application framework with expressive, elegant syntax. We’ve already laid the foundation for your next big idea — freeing you to create without sweating the small things.

  • Laravel is an open-source PHP framework on GitHub with 75.7k stars and 24.2k forks used for building web applications. It was first released in 2011 and follows the Model-View-Controller (MVC) architecture. It comes with an expressive and elegant syntax. It is fine-tuned for building professional web applications and ready to handle enterprise workloads. It achieves this by integrating the best packages from the PHP ecosystem and creating a framework that is also developer-friendly. Other than its foundational features, It also provides tools for dependency injection, unit testing, real-time events, and many more.

  • Yii2

    Yii 2: The Fast, Secure and Professional PHP Framework

  • Yii is one of the oldest PHP frameworks, acronym as Yes It Is! It has 14.2k stars and 7k forks on GitHub. It is a fast, secure, and flexible PHP framework for web development, especially for building MVC architecture websites. It is an Object-Oriented PHP framework that requires knowledge of inheritance, polymorphism, etc.

  • CodeIgniter

    Open Source PHP Framework (originally from EllisLab)

  • CodeIgniter is an open-source PHP framework with 18k+ stars and 7.8K forks on GitHub. It follows the Model-View-Controller (MVC) architecture and provides a structured way to create and organize code. It provides a set of libraries and an intuitive interface to accelerate PHP web app development.

  • Slim

    Slim Framework 4 Skeleton Application

  • Slim is a micro PHP framework used for web development with 11.7k stars and 2k forks on GitHub. It has a simple and intuitive API development process. It is a micro-framework, meaning you only get a minimum of support for HTTP requests and forwarding requests to appropriate controllers. So the question is, why should you choose a micro-framework? Because it offers you flexibility and high extensibility.

  • Symfony

    The Symfony PHP framework

  • Symfony is an open-source PHP framework developed by SensioLabs which has a thriving community of over 300,000 developers with 29k stars and 9.4k forks on GitHub. It provides a set of reusable PHP components and a development methodology for building complex and scalable web applications. It is recommended due to its advanced features and user-friendly environment. The user can also develop microservices.

  • FuelPHP

    Fuel PHP Framework v1.x is a simple, flexible, community driven PHP 5.3+ framework, based on the best ideas of other frameworks, with a fresh start! FuelPHP is now fully PHP 8.0 compatible. (by fuel)

  • FuelPHP is a portable and extensible PHP framework that supports both MVC and Hierarchical Model-View-Controller (HMVC) architectures with 1.5k stars and 300+ forks on GitHub. It works on almost any server and is characterized by a clean syntax. It is a purely object-oriented approach. The applications can be divided into modules, and each module can be extended or replaced without having to rewrite a single line of code.

  • Phalcon

    High performance, full-stack PHP framework delivered as a C extension.

  • Phalcon is open-source with 10.7k stars and 2k+ forks on GitHub. It is a full-stack framework for PHP that is characterized by high performance and low resource consumption. It is written or implemented as a C-extension or in C, which is integrated into PHP to improve performance. It has a user-friendly interface that simplifies PHP development and enhances the developer experience.

  • Project

    A lightweight MVC PHP framework designed for speed and simplicty (by PHPixie)

  • PHPixie is an open-source PHP web framework designed for high-speed and simple web applications with 1k stars and 131 forks on GitHub. It was initially started as a micro framework but gradually evolved into a full-stack framework. It is a lightweight MVC PHP framework that has its own query builder and ORM. It is built with independent components and also receives regular updates and enhancements.

  • Lumen

    Discontinued The Laravel Lumen Framework.

  • Lumen is also a micro-framework used for developing PHP-powered web applications with 7.6k stars and 1k forks on GitHub. It is based on the Laravel framework and is specifically designed to build microservices and smaller, lightweight applications. The same team behind Laravel creates it and also shares some of its components. But, It is different from Laravel because it doesn’t offer compatibility with any additional Laravel libraries like Cashier, Passport, Scout, etc.

  • fatfree

    A powerful yet easy-to-use PHP micro-framework designed to help you build dynamic and robust Web applications - fast!

  • Fat-Free Framework also known as F3, is an open-source PHP micro-framework designed for building web applications. It has 2.6k stars and 400+ forks on GitHub. It allows you only to use the necessary code. It doesn’t need complex configuration, such as setting up Composer, curl, or a complex directory structure. It supports SQL and NoSQL databases like MySQL, SQLite, MSSQL/Sybase, PostgreSQL, MongoDB, etc.
